Frequently Asked Questions

What types of spa treatments are most popular in Cherokee, given its small-town, relaxing atmosphere?

In Cherokee, the most sought-after treatments are those that promote deep relaxation and stress relief, perfectly matching the town's tranquil pace. You'll find that massages, including deep tissue and hot stone, are extremely popular, along with rejuvenating facials that use natural products. Many local spas also offer specialized packages that combine multiple services for a full day of pampering.

How far in advance should I book a spa appointment in Cherokee?

It's highly recommended to book your appointment at least one to two weeks in advance, especially for weekends. Due to the limited number of spa facilities in the Cherokee area, popular time slots fill up quickly. For holiday seasons or if you're planning a group visit, booking even further ahead is advisable to secure your preferred date and time.

What is the typical cancellation policy for day spas in Cherokee?

Cancellation policies are generally strict due to high demand and limited appointment availability. Most spas in Cherokee require at least a 24 to 48-hour notice for cancellations or rescheduling to avoid a fee, which is often the full cost of the scheduled service. We strongly recommend confirming the specific policy at the time of booking.

Do day spas in Cherokee offer gift certificates, and where can I purchase them?

Absolutely. Purchasing a gift certificate is a wonderful way to share the relaxing experience of a Cherokee day spa. They are typically available for purchase directly through the spa's website or by phone. Many local businesses may also sell them on-site. They can usually be customized for a specific dollar amount or for a particular service or package.
